Texas Death Records.
Searching for Texas Death Records in this state can be done through the Texas Vital Statistics Department of State Health Services, the office which is empowered by the state government to cater to those needs regarding this matter. Requesting for such information in this department can be done either by personally going into the office and wait for the response after 15-20 business days, or you may also do it online through the state’s official eGovernment website, the TexasOnline.

In conducting your own search for these obituaries, you have to consider some helpful tips. To start with, you may talk to your local newspapers in the city to obtain such information for free. Another way is to go to those public libraries since they often have copies of those years and years of newspapers which can be a good source for your obituary search. Still another means is through the Internet which is proven to be the most useful and the fastest way of searching for the information that you need. This time, you can already have access to those databases online where all the information that you need are stored.
Every person has his own reason for searching Free Public Death Records. This information is usually utilized as a good source of information by those who are conducting a study of their genealogy or family history. That’s because this file is loaded with a lot of relevant information about the person who died. The standard information that it reveals include the personal particulars of the person such as his name, age, birth record, address, spouse, and children and surviving family. It also indicates the when, where, and why he died, and his honors, too.
A death certificate is one vital document that will be provided to you by the authorized government once you’ve conducted a search for this death record. The said certificate officially declares the person’s death, and the information about when, where, and why he died. Generally, these types of documents are public documents as per the law of the state. That means that any member of the public can freely have access to these files as long as he properly goes through the policies and procedures that the state is implementing.
